excel中出现ref代表什么
作者:路由通
|

发布时间:2025-09-15 09:34:10
标签:
引用错误是电子表格操作中常见的提示信息,通常意味着公式中引用的单元格位置失效。本文将从错误成因、解决方案、预防措施三个维度,系统解析十二种典型场景及其应对方法,帮助用户彻底掌握引用错误的处理技巧。
.webp)
引用错误的本质解析 当公式中引用的单元格区域被删除或移动时,计算引擎无法找到原始数据源,就会触发引用错误提示。这种错误不同于数值计算错误或数据类型错误,其核心特征是原始引用目标丢失。例如将包含公式"=A1+B1"的工作表中A列整列删除后,公式会自动转换为"=REF!+B1"的报错状态。删除行列引发的典型错误 在实际操作中,直接删除被公式引用的行列是最常见的错误诱因。某企业财务报表中原先设置"=C3:D8"区域汇总公式,当财务人员误删第三行后,所有引用该区域的公式立即显示引用错误。通过撤销操作恢复数据后,错误提示自动消失,这印证了错误与数据源完整性的直接关联。跨工作表引用失效场景 跨表引用时若目标工作表被重命名或删除,同样会触发引用错误。例如在年度汇总表中设置"=SUM(一月!B2:B10)"公式,当将"一月"工作表改名为"1月"时,公式会自动转为"=SUM(REF!B2:B10)"。此时需要手动修改公式中的工作表名称,或通过查找替换功能批量更新引用关系。剪切粘贴操作的风险 移动单元格内容时若使用剪切操作,可能破坏已有的公式引用链。某销售数据表中原本设置"=VLOOKUP(F2,A:B,2,0)"查询公式,当将A列数据剪切至D列时,公式中的A:B引用范围将立即失效。建议改用复制粘贴操作,或在移动前先将公式中的相对引用改为绝对引用。动态引用区域的隐患 使用偏移量、索引等函数创建动态引用时,若参数设置超出实际数据范围,极易产生引用错误。例如设置"=OFFSET(A1,0,0,COUNT(A:A),1)"公式动态选取A列数据,当A列数据被清空时,高度参数变为0,公式将返回引用错误。可通过结合使用若错误函数进行错误捕获,确保公式稳定性。合并单元格的潜在问题 合并单元格操作会改变原始单元格的地址参照系。某项目进度表中原设置"=C5/D5"计算完成率,当将C4:C6合并后,公式自动变为"=REF!/D5"。这是因为合并后C5单元格实际上不再独立存在。建议先取消所有公式引用后再执行合并操作,或改用其他布局方式替代单元格合并。外部链接断裂的情形 引用其他工作簿数据时,当源文件被移动、重命名或删除,就会出现链接断裂错误。例如"=[预算.xlsx]Sheet1!$B$3"在源文件改名后会自动转为"=[REF!]Sheet1!$B$3"。可通过数据选项卡中的"编辑链接"功能重新定位源文件,或使用间接引用配合文件路径字符串实现柔性链接。数组公式的特殊性 数组公式对引用区域的变化尤为敏感。某统计分析表中使用"=SUM(IF(A1:A10>0,B1:B10))"数组公式,当删除第5行后,公式引用范围不会自动调整,仍然坚持引用原有的A1:A10区域,导致出现REF!错误。此时需要手动修改数组公式的引用范围,或改用动态数组函数重新构建公式。名称管理的引用问题 通过名称管理器定义的命名范围若被误删,相关公式将全部报错。例如定义名称"销售额"指向Sheet1!B2:B100后,在公式中使用"=SUM(销售额)"。若意外删除B列,名称管理器中的引用会自动变为"=Sheet1!REF!",导致所有使用该名称的公式失效。建议定期检查名称管理器的引用状态,及时更新无效引用。条件格式中的引用错误 条件格式规则中若包含单元格引用,同样会受到引用错误影响。某数据表中设置"=$B2>AVERAGE($B$2:$B$50)"的条件格式规则,当删除B列后,规则中的引用会自动转为"=REF!>AVERAGE(REF!REF!)"。此时需要重新编辑条件格式规则,或通过格式刷功能重新应用正确的格式规则。
数据验证的关联影响 数据验证功能中若设置序列引用特定单元格区域,当这些单元格被删除时会导致验证功能失效。例如在数据验证中设置"=INDIRECT($F$1)"动态引用序列源,当F1单元格被删除后,下拉列表将无法正常显示选项。解决方法是在数据验证设置中改用静态区域引用,或通过公式确保引用的单元格不会被意外修改。宏代码引发的引用错误 VBA代码中若使用硬编码单元格地址,当工作表结构变化时可能引发运行时错误。某自动化报表宏中包含"Range("C5").Value"代码,当用户插入行列后,原C5单元格可能偏移到D6位置。建议在VBA代码中使用命名范围或动态查找方法定位单元格,避免使用固定地址引用。错误排查的实用技巧 当出现引用错误时,可使用公式审核工具追踪引用关系。通过"公式"选项卡中的"追踪引用单元格"功能,以箭头方式直观显示公式的引用来源。若箭头指向红色叉号标记,即可确定具体是哪个引用源出现了问题。同时结合按下F2键进入单元格编辑模式,被错误引用部分会以特殊颜色高亮显示。预防措施的最佳实践 建立规范的数据管理流程是避免引用错误的根本方法。建议在重要公式中使用表格结构化引用替代单元格区域引用,例如将"=SUM(B2:B100)"改为"=SUM(Table1[销售额])"。同时定期使用"查找->定位->公式->错误"功能快速定位所有存在引用错误的单元格,及时进行修复处理。错误处理的函数方案 若错误函数可有效防止引用错误导致的计算中断。例如将"=VLOOKUP(A2,数据区,2,0)"改为"=IFERROR(VLOOKUP(A2,数据区,2,0),"未找到")",即使引用失效也不会影响其他公式运算。对于重要报表,建议建立错误检查机制,使用条件格式标记出存在引用错误的单元格,便于快速识别和处理。版本兼容性注意事项 不同版本对引用错误的处理方式存在差异。在较早版本中,移动工作表可能导致更严重的引用链断裂。建议在共享文件时注明使用版本要求,或先将公式转换为数值后再进行文件传递。对于跨版本协作场景,可设置引用错误自动提醒机制,通过条件格式或辅助列监控关键公式的引用状态。云端协作的特殊考量 在多人协同编辑环境下,引用错误的发生概率显著增加。某在线表格中设置"=B2C2"公式后,其他用户若清空B列数据,会导致公式报错。建议在共享文件中设置保护区域,限制对公式引用区域的修改权限。同时建立变更日志记录,便于追溯引用错误的产生原因和责任人。引用错误是数据处理过程中的常见问题,其本质是公式与数据源之间的连接断裂。通过理解错误产生机制、掌握排查方法、实施预防措施,用户可以显著降低错误发生频率。建议结合使用错误处理函数、结构化引用和规范操作流程,构建健壮的数据处理体系。
相关文章
在Excel中进行连续复制操作时,按键选择至关重要,本篇文章将深入探讨各种快捷键和方法的实际应用。通过引用官方权威资料,结合多个案例,详细解析控制键、拖拽技巧及其他组合键的使用,帮助用户提升工作效率。文章涵盖12个核心论点,每个均配以实用案例,确保内容专业且易于理解。
2025-09-15 09:33:43

本文深入探讨Excel中常见的下标越界错误,从VBA编程、公式引用、数据管理等多角度分析12个核心原因,每个论点辅以实际案例,帮助用户快速识别并解决此类问题,提升工作效率。
2025-09-15 09:33:36

本文详细解析电子表格软件中日期格式设置的完整菜单路径与操作技巧。从基础功能区到高级自定义设置,涵盖12个核心操作场景,每个步骤配实际案例演示,帮助用户快速掌握日期格式的专业调整方法。
2025-09-15 09:33:18

本文深入解析Microsoft Word中整段移动现象的成因与应对策略。从误操作、格式设置到自动功能影响,系统分析12个核心原因,每个论点辅以真实案例和官方建议,帮助用户有效预防和解决文档处理中的常见问题,提升工作效率。
2025-09-15 09:32:49

加号符号(+)是数学和计算中的基本运算符,代表加法操作。在文字处理软件如Microsoft Word中,加号用于公式、列表和搜索功能。本文将深入探讨加号符号的定义、历史起源、在各种上下文中的使用案例,以及实用技巧,帮助用户全面掌握这一常见符号的应用。
2025-09-15 09:32:46

本文深度解析苹果手机型号大全,从初代iPhone到最新系列,详尽介绍每个型号的关键特性、发布背景及实用信息。基于官方资料,提供全面攻略,帮助用户深入了解苹果手机的发展历程和选择指南。
2025-09-15 09:32:36

热门推荐
资讯中心: